Last night, country musician/”Highway Boy” Zach Bryan returned to the Crypto.com Arena in Los Angeles to close his regional stay after arriving the night prior, June 3, for the first of two back-to-back concerts at the venue above. During the June 4 show, the headliner brought out a special guest at two points; John Mayer took the opportunity to assist on the unreleased “Better Days” and later, for the encore, “Revival.” 

The pair’s journey to Tuesday night’s collaboration can be traced back to a February 2022 Tweet from the country artist, who referenced seeing Mayer live at Madison Square Garden in New York City while “painfully sober,” calling the performance not overrated and even ranking Mayer as a top three genius of our time. Notably, Bryan teased the potential for studio work last fall with a now-deleted post to social media, capturing the pair and others in a studio-like setting. 

During the Tuesday concert, Mayer arrived a couple of songs into the halfway point, first helping out on the yet-to-be-released “Better Days,” a concert frequenter for the artist on the latest leg of his tour. After leaving the stage and allowing the billed act to add originals to the night’s stats, Mayer reappeared during the evening’s encore, a single song delivery of the Elisabeth originator, “Revival.” 

Mayer’s sit-in arrived before Dead & Company’s fourth week of residency concerts, which will pick up tomorrow, June 6. Sphere shows will continue throughout the weekend, June 7 and 8. Tickets remain on sale.
